Replacement Of AHC22958 Hydraulic Cylinder

The AHC22958 hydraulic cylinder is a crucial component in various heavy machinery, including the 1775NT model. It plays a vital role in enabling smooth and efficient operation by providing the necessary force for different applications.

Specifications

  • Weight: 112.063 lb
  • Height: 8.4 in
  • Length: 25.2 in

Fault Diagnosis and Common Issues

Hydraulic cylinder faults can hinder performance and productivity. Here are some common issues to be aware of:

  1. Leakage: Inspect the cylinder for any signs of oil leakage, which can indicate damaged seals or other internal issues.
  2. Poor Operation: If the cylinder’s movement becomes jerky or uneven, it may point to internal damage or misalignment.
  3. Lack of Power: Insufficient force exerted by the cylinder can result from worn-out components or inadequate hydraulic pressure.

Sealing and Lubrication

Proper sealing and lubrication play vital roles in the performance and longevity of hydraulic cylinders:

  • Various sealing elements, such as piston seals and rod seals, should be made of wear-resistant materials like polyurethane or nitrile rubber.
  • Cylinder bodies and threaded ends should undergo precision treatments to enhance wear resistance.
  • Regular lubrication with the appropriate amount of hydraulic oil ensures smooth operation and minimizes wear and tear.
